Good air output. Not really bladeless or super-quiet though.
The pureFlow QT7 hides the fan blades inside it. It blows a lot of air using essentially the venturi effect; it pushes a bit of air fast, which drags other air with it. Kind of cool. It also allows for a neat shape. The Good: Fashionable. It looks really neat, like something out of Space: 1999. (Does that make it retro-futuristic?) It's reasonably quiet. But not really very quiet. It can move a good amount of air. But at the higher settings, very noisily. The blades are hidden. It's extremely adjustable. You can point it at the ceiling. That's HUGE, as it lets you move the entire room's air around. The remote works. The Bad: Ummm... ummm.... The light on it is overly bright. I taped a business card onto it. Flip the card up to use the front controls. There are 12 fan settings, but it only cycles up. To go from 6 to 5, you have to press "+" eleven times. We're quite happy with this fan.

Looks like a giant camera spying on you but it's Great as a Fan
Out of the box, I was not too thrilled with the look and feel of this bladeless fan. Not a fan of the R2D2 look but it has grown on me since. It felt somewhat cheap and wobbly for the price but found it was wobbly on the bottom because it's a turn table for when the fan oscillates. Which it does very well. I only wish you could adjust how much it oscillates. It's a fixed 90 Degrees but it's what I'd typically use anyway. I was also miffed that it didn't have a stand. But I found that it moves vertically from pointing straight ahead to pointing at the sealing if you need it to. So you don't really need a stand but it works better to set in on a table if you want to fan higher areas. At the highest setting the fan is actually fairly loud and somewhat powerful but at the lowest setting it is soothing and drastically quieter. I love this fan on the lowest setting sitting in my office chair blowing a gentle breeze in my face. Very calming and feels natural. So I'd say one star off just for the fact that it's somewhat ugly looking (unless you dig the Futurama look) but as a fan it is top notch. Which I guess is the most important reason to have it in the first place. ;)
